12.27.6

Alternative
Symbol:
This command (category 'SFC') available in the SFC Editor transforms a parallel branch
to an alternative branch.
Notice that after a branch transformation you must check and adapt the chart
appropriately, that is you must arrange steps and transitions as required for the
respective type of branching.

12.27.8

Insert branch right
Symbol:
This command (category 'SFC') is used in the SFC-Editor to insert a branch right to the
currently selected element(s). (To insert it each left to the currently selected step, use
command Insert branch.)
• If the uppermost element of the current selection is a transition or an alternative

branch, an alternative branch will be created.

• If the uppermost element of the current selection is a step, a macro, a jump or a

parallel branch, a parallel branch with label "Branch<x>" will be inserted. This is a
default label name where x is a running number. You can edit the label name. The
branch label might be used as a jump target.

• If currently a common element of an existing branch is selected (horizontal line),

the new branch will be added to the existing branches on the right most position. If
currently a complete arm of an existing branch is selected (horizontal line), the new
branch will be added directly right to that one.

Note: Notice that branches can be transformed by commands 'Alternative' and
'Parallel'.
